реклама на сайте
подробности

 
 
> Потребление EFM32TG840
kartoshechka
сообщение Nov 17 2011, 08:05
Сообщение #1





Группа: Новичок
Сообщений: 5
Регистрация: 17-11-11
Пользователь №: 68 358



Добрый день!
Разжилась отладкой на EFM32TG. Пробую перенести на неё небольшой проект - использую ACMP, PRS и TIMER, считаю импульсы при этом сплю в EM1. Ожидала потребление в районе 150мкА, но пока получается 430 - в чём может быть проблема? Кто-нибудь сталкивался с таким?
Go to the top of the page
 
+Quote Post
 
Start new topic
Ответов
KnightIgor
сообщение Nov 17 2011, 08:36
Сообщение #2


Знающий
****

Группа: Участник
Сообщений: 643
Регистрация: 29-05-09
Из: Германия
Пользователь №: 49 725



Цитата(kartoshechka @ Nov 17 2011, 10:05) *
Добрый день!
Разжилась отладкой на EFM32TG. Пробую перенести на неё небольшой проект - использую ACMP, PRS и TIMER, считаю импульсы при этом сплю в EM1. Ожидала потребление в районе 150мкА, но пока получается 430 - в чём может быть проблема? Кто-нибудь сталкивался с таким?

Где производится измерение потребления? Может быть различные регуляторы питания процессора сами по себе потребляют (токи покоя). Либо какие-то выводы с PullUp сопротивлениями (как-то I2C) проинициализированы на "0" Кроме того, возможно включена (затактирована) лишняя периферия.
Go to the top of the page
 
+Quote Post
kartoshechka
сообщение Nov 17 2011, 08:48
Сообщение #3





Группа: Новичок
Сообщений: 5
Регистрация: 17-11-11
Пользователь №: 68 358



Цитата(KnightIgor @ Nov 17 2011, 10:36) *
Где производится измерение потребления? Может быть различные регуляторы питания процессора сами по себе потребляют (токи покоя). Либо какие-то выводы с PullUp сопротивлениями (как-то I2C) проинициализированы на "0" Кроме того, возможно включена (затактирована) лишняя периферия.

всё по дефолту выключено, неиспользуемые GPIO отключены. Конкретно в этом случае меряю через AEM, но пробовала мультиметром - тоже самое... Тоже кажется что какая то периферия не выключилась, но пока так и не нашла...
Go to the top of the page
 
+Quote Post
Gas Wilson
сообщение Nov 17 2011, 09:00
Сообщение #4


Участник
*

Группа: Участник
Сообщений: 39
Регистрация: 11-10-07
Пользователь №: 31 261



Цитата(kartoshechka @ Nov 17 2011, 12:48) *
всё по дефолту выключено, неиспользуемые GPIO отключены. Конкретно в этом случае меряю через AEM, но пробовала мультиметром - тоже самое... Тоже кажется что какая то периферия не выключилась, но пока так и не нашла...


Была похожая тема. У них походу отладочный блок потребляет разницу. Случайно не используешь setupSWO??? Я её выключил и всё пришло в норму sm.gif На моей задаче было 157мкА в EM1 при похожей периферии.
Кстати у них есть ещё одна особенность - когда высокая частота прерываний отладочный интерфейс не успевает их передавать в Profiler. Вроде обещали поправить.
Go to the top of the page
 
+Quote Post
kartoshechka
сообщение Nov 17 2011, 09:13
Сообщение #5





Группа: Новичок
Сообщений: 5
Регистрация: 17-11-11
Пользователь №: 68 358



Цитата(Gas Wilson @ Nov 17 2011, 11:00) *
Была похожая тема. У них походу отладочный блок потребляет разницу. Случайно не используешь setupSWO??? Я её выключил и всё пришло в норму sm.gif На моей задаче было 157мкА в EM1 при похожей периферии.
Кстати у них есть ещё одна особенность - когда высокая частота прерываний отладочный интерфейс не успевает их передавать в Profiler. Вроде обещали поправить.

Да. как раз setupSWO включила. Сегодня попробую без неё.
Go to the top of the page
 
+Quote Post
kartoshechka
сообщение Nov 22 2011, 12:56
Сообщение #6





Группа: Новичок
Сообщений: 5
Регистрация: 17-11-11
Пользователь №: 68 358



Все супер.Спасибо!
Go to the top of the page
 
+Quote Post



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 22nd July 2025 - 21:40
Рейтинг@Mail.ru


Страница сгенерированна за 0.014 секунд с 7
ELECTRONIX ©2004-2016